Paperback. Etat : New. Print on Demand. This book delves into the history and evolution of negotiable instruments, specifically bills of exchange and promissory notes, in the United States. The author examines the complex interplay of common law and statutory law as it applies to this area of legal practice. The text includes a wealth of historical context, tracing the origins of negotiable instruments back to their Continental European roots, and highlighting the distinct approaches taken by American and British legal systems. The author's deep understanding of the subject is evident in the detailed annotations, which provide summaries of important legal cases and highlight the challenges of achieving consistent legal interpretation across different states. The book's discussion of the Negotiable Instruments Law, enacted in a majority of U.S. states by 1915, provides a comprehensive overview of this critical piece of legal legislation and its impact on the commercial world. This book offers invaluable insights for legal professionals and historians alike, providing a detailed account of the legal framework that governs negotiable instruments in the United States.
